Warm, Hearty Family Style Meal. No Family Required.

New Stove Top Quick Cups Delivers the Taste of a Home-Cooked Family Meal Even When Dining Alone or On the Go

GLENVIEW, Ill. (October 14, 2008) – Between errands, late nights and demanding work schedules, eating on your own in place of dining with family has become commonplace. Thanks to new Stove Top Quick Cups, you can enjoy the taste of a home-cooked family meal even when you’re on the go.

New Stove Top Quick Cups delivers the delicious flavor and aroma of traditional Stove Top Stuffing in a quick, convenient microwavable cup. Whether noshing on last night’s leftovers or grabbing a quick lunch at the office, Stove Top Quick Cups is an easy complement to any meal. Just add hot water and heat for up to 60 seconds in the microwave – no stove or pots needed.

“Stove Top Stuffing is known for helping to make warm and special family meals, and now new Quick Cups extends that family feeling to the dinner-for-one experience,” said Stove Top Brand Manager Ellen Wiese. “Stove Top Quick Cups allows you to savor the delicious flavor and warmth of Stove Top when you’re on the go or making dinner on your own.”

Flavorful Offerings
Stove Top Quick Cups is available in two varieties, chicken and cornbread. Each twoserving Quick Cups provides a warm, flavorful addition to any meal. Starting in October, Stove Top Quick Cups are available nationwide with a suggested retail price of $0.99.

About Kraft Foods Inc.
For more than a century, Kraft (www.kraft.com) has offered delicious foods and beverages that fit the way consumers live. Today, we are turning the brands that consumers have lived with for years into brands they can’t live without. Millions of times a day in more than 150 countries, consumers reach for their favorite Kraft brands, including nine with revenues exceeding $1 billion: Kraft cheeses, dinners and dressings; Oscar Mayer meats; Philadelphia cream cheese; Maxwell House coffee; Nabisco cookies and crackers and its Oreo brand; Jacobs coffees; Milka chocolates; and LU biscuits. Kraft is one of the world’s largest food and beverage companies with annual revenues exceeding $37 billion, more than 100,000 employees and more than 180 manufacturing and processing facilities globally. The company’s stock (NYSE: KFT) is listed on the Standard & Poor’s 100 and 500 indexes as well as the Dow Jones Sustainability Index and Ethibel Sustainability Index.
